Answer:

The side DE is 4.2 units long, approximately.

Step-by-step explanation:

In the given triangle, side DE is the hypothenuse. So, we can use Pythagorean's Theorem, where both legs are 3 units long.

[tex]DE^{2}=DF^{2}+EF^{2}\\ DE^{2}=3^{2}+3^{2}\\DE^{2}=9+9\\DE=\sqrt{18} \approx 4.2[/tex]

Therefore, the side DE is 4.2 units long, approximately.
